Our guest Britt Larsen shares her perspective and experience from years of working in Washington D.C. and for a former Florida State Governor. We talk about divine interests and allowing the Holy Ghost to inspire us in how to get involved while also keeping our perspective on the Savior. We discuss how to interact with and influence our immediate circles, especially those who may affiliate differently than we do. Thoughts are shared from a non-partisan perspective throughout, and the golden nuggets we talk about are applicable to individuals on any side of the political aisle!

Early in her career, Britt Larsen became the Director of Communications for a prominent Congressman in Washington, DC. During the 2012 presidential election, she managed the communications efforts during the Iowa Caucus and led strategy for her boss as he moderated the CNN South Carolina Presidential Candidate Debate.

From DC, she was recruited to be the Director of Communications under the Governor of Florida. She served as the Department of State Public Information Officer overseeing state elections and the on-camera official spokeswoman and speechwriter for the Secretary of State and agency of over 600 employees.

Britt then moved into the private sector and since has directed public affairs strategy and communications for political campaigns, startups and established enterprise companies. Past clients include Microsoft, Delta, Pfizer, Children's Miracle Network Hospitals, Merit Medical, Subway, United Airlines, Joann Fabrics, Extra Space Storage and several statewide and national political campaigns. As the youngest and only female Vice President at her last firm, she instituted a completely new structure for client strategy and hired more than 50% of employees.
